Chapter 188 The Tail



Zhao Zhi and Shen Hanshan originally intended to send Zhao Shouzhen to the princess's residence for treatment, but just as they were about to arrive at the princess's residence, Shen Hanshan suddenly changed his mind and decided to send him to the Zhao residence instead.

Zhao Zhi instantly realized—they had a tail behind them!

Startled, she knew she couldn't go directly to the princess's residence now, so she cried out "Ouch!" and pretended to twist her ankle. In that instant of looking down, she quickly pinpointed the location of the person hiding in the shadows who was following them, then swiftly leaped over, channeling her inner energy into the silver needle in her hand, and aimed and shot it in that direction.

The man clearly hadn't expected Zhao Zhi to suddenly attack, and the silver needle struck his Jianjing acupoint with perfect accuracy.

He groaned, his body stiffened, and then he collapsed to the ground. Zhao Zhi quickly stepped forward, ripped off the black veil covering his face, revealing an unfamiliar face.

"Who are you? Why are you following us?" Zhao Zhi's voice was icy cold, a glint of cold light flashing in her eyes. She stared at the man she had subdued, awaiting his answer. However, the man gritted his teeth and refused to speak.

Du Heng, who had arrived a step too late, strode forward, his gaze sharp as a knife as he stared at the man, and said coldly, "Won't talk? Then let me show you the interrogation methods of our Prince! Once you fall into our Prince's hands, you'll wish you were dead..."

A flicker of panic crossed the man's eyes, his lips pressed tightly together, as if he were still hesitating whether to confess. But in the end, fear overcame him, and his lips trembled slightly as he finally spoke: "I...I was entrusted by someone to monitor your movements."

Upon hearing this, Zhao Zhi frowned and continued to press, "Who entrusted you with this?"

The man hesitated for a moment, his face turning extremely pale, but he still refused to reveal who was behind it all. Just then, he suddenly closed his eyes and his body went limp.

Du Heng stepped forward for a closer examination and discovered that the man had died from poisoning.

Zhao Zhi and Du Heng exchanged a glance, both simultaneously suspecting that Li Liang was likely behind it all. After all, only he had the motive and ability to orchestrate such a thing.

Zhao Zhi didn't have time to think much, and quickly took two steps at a time to catch up with Shen Hanshan, who had already gone far away.

As the two men helped Zhao Shouzhen to the entrance of the Zhao residence, they were suddenly horrified to see a blood-soaked, gruesome figure lying at the gate. Zhao Zhi stared blankly at the stranger, while Shen Hanshan recognized him at a glance.

“Isn’t this Li Afu?” he said softly. He remembered that when Bai Wei and her entourage came to Chaoyang County with the Princess’s carriage, Li Afu had been taking care of the women along the way, and had won the appreciation of Bai Wei and Zhao Yun.

At this moment, Li Afu was breathing very weakly, as if he might die at any moment, clearly indicating that he was seriously injured. Du Heng quickly signaled to the two soldiers beside him, instructing them to carefully help Li Afu up and carry him into the courtyard.

At the same time, a loud cry came from Zhao Yun's room.

It turned out that after a night of hardship and a brush with death, Zhao Yun finally gave birth to a daughter.

Upon hearing the baby's cries, Zhao Shouzhen, who had been unconscious, slightly opened his eyes, mumbled something incoherently, and then fell unconscious again.

Inside the house, Bai Wei saw that Zhao Yun had safely given birth to the child, and her heart, which had been pounding all night, finally eased a little. She held Zhao Yun's hand tightly and said with heartache, "Yun'er, you've worked so hard."

Zhao Yun was exhausted after a long night and had no strength left to speak, but her eyes were full of joy and relief. Her gaze drifted towards the door, and tears unexpectedly fell.

“Miss, Madam has been delayed by some matters. There was a disturbance in the city last night, and it only calmed down this morning. I heard from Li Afu that Master took a long spear to support the guards at the city gate, and I don’t know if he has returned yet.”

Yu Ming looked at Zhao Yun and the child, her heart filled with mixed feelings of joy and worry.

"Quickly—go—to—see—" Zhao Yun shouted in a hoarse voice.

"Alright! This servant will go and find out the news right away." Yu Ming readily agreed, and jogged out of the house, lifting the curtain as she went.

To her surprise, as soon as she stepped out of the door, she saw a blood-soaked figure walk past her. Startled, she screamed "Ah!" and then, remembering that there were other people in the house, she hurriedly covered her mouth.

But it was too late.

Zhao Yun's heart leaped into her throat upon hearing Yu Ming's terrified scream. She exchanged a fearful glance with Bai Wei and pleaded weakly in a low voice, "Please, I'm in this state, I definitely can't escape. You must raise the child."

Bai Wei was much older than her, so she gestured for Bai Lian to go and see what was happening outside.

Bai Lian nodded in agreement, tiptoed out, and quickly returned. She whispered a few words in Bai Wei's ear, and Bai Wei waved her hand, signaling her to go out and help.

Zhao Yun looked at Bai Wei with suspicion, wanting to know what had happened outside.

Bai Wei suppressed her grief and calmly said, "It's just that Li Afu was injured. Yu Ming is just a young girl who has never seen fighting and killing before. It's understandable that she's a little scared after seeing blood. You've been working hard all night, so get some rest. Your father and mother have some things to take care of, and they'll come to see you when they're done."

Hearing Bai Wei say that, Zhao Yun felt a pang of sadness. In her parents' hearts, it seemed that she was always the one who was not valued.

On the other side, Zhao Zhi carefully examined Zhao Shouzhen's body. Fortunately, it was just fainting due to exhaustion. Although he had several superficial wounds, none of them were fatal, and with some careful recuperation, he would gradually recover.

Zhao Zhi sat by the bed, gazing at the unconscious Zhao Shouzhen, pondering to herself: Who exactly is manipulating all of this behind the scenes? She knew that this undercurrent of struggle had only just begun.
